In Mitochondria and the Future of Medicine, naturopathic doctor Lee Know tells the epic story of mitochondria - the widely misunderstood and often-overlooked powerhouses of our cells. The legendary saga began over two billion years ago, when one bacterium entered another without being digested, which would evolve to create the first mitochondrion. Since then, for life to exist beyond single-celled bacteria, it's the mitochondria that have been responsible for this life-giving energy.

To be fair, nutritional science is moving forward as fast as computing science, renewable energy and other new sciences (yes, nutrition is still only 6 weeks of elective subjects for medical students and covered in Year 1 of a 15 year program).
However, there is a complete lack of understanding of the falling nutritional value of produce today; that our taste drives that push us to hidden hunger; of the relevance of phytonutrients to health; and the importance of our microbiome and the gut-brain links.
You get this sort of information in the weekly women's magazines and rubbish online sites and it is 5 years or more behind true nutritional understanding.

What made the experience of listening to The Fat Switch the most enjoyable?
The revelation and relevance of fructose as the sugar that turns on the fat switch and how our modern food supply is preparing us for hibernation rather than sustaining us for ideal health.
Who was your favorite character and why?
Fructose is the bad guy, Just wait. It won't be long and everyone will be talking about good sugars and bad sugars in the same way as good and bad fats are becoming familiar to us now.
Have you listened to any of Brian Holsopple’s other performances before? How does this one compare?
He struggles with some of the biochemical terms but it's no big deal.
Did you have an extreme reaction to this book? Did it make you laugh or cry?
It is a work of non-fiction and as such, was an eye-opener in so far as the new insights and discoveries presented and how they extend the field of nutritional science into new areas of knowledge.
Any additional comments?
The major omission is the relevance of antioxidants and anti-inflammatories which moderate insulin and leptin resistance, ameliorate metaflammation and have a significant influence on nutrition as well as improving the success of low carb, high protein dieting regimes.
